Core Architecture Differences

While both platforms aim to revolutionize social media, Bluesky and Mastodon employ fundamentally different architectural approaches that shape their user experiences. The core architecture of Bluesky's AT Protocol enables seamless cross-platform interaction and customization through Personal Data Servers, while Mastodon's ActivityPub protocol creates distinct communities through independent instances.

Feature Bluesky Mastodon
Protocol AT Protocol ActivityPub
Server Structure Centralized with PDS options Federated instances
Content Distribution Platform-wide Instance-based
Feed Customization 50,000+ algorithmic options Instance-dependent
User Control Universal connectivity Community-specific

This architectural distinction notably impacts users' ability to customize their experience, share content, and interact across the platform, positioning Bluesky as a more dynamically adaptable solution for modern social media needs.

Privacy Features and Data Control

As social media users become increasingly concerned about data privacy, Mastodon and Bluesky have implemented distinct approaches to user control and information security. Both platforms prioritize decentralized architectures, with Mastodon utilizing instance-based privacy policies and Bluesky employing Personal Data Servers for enhanced data control.

Key privacy features across both platforms include:

  1. Mastodon's decentralized instances enable customized moderation services and privacy standards per community.
  2. Bluesky's PDS architecture allows users to maintain control over their personal data storage.
  3. Neither platform offers end-to-end encryption for direct messages, leaving content accessible to administrators.
  4. Content deletion capabilities exist but face limitations once information spreads across networks.

These privacy frameworks represent a significant shift from traditional centralized social media models, though both platforms continue addressing challenges in data protection and content permanence.

Content Moderation Approaches

Content moderation strategies between Mastodon and Bluesky represent divergent philosophical approaches to managing user-generated content.

Mastodon's decentralized model empowers instance administrators to establish localized moderation policies, enabling communities to self-regulate through defederation and customized rules.

Bluesky adopts a centralized moderation framework, implementing automated labeling services and platform-wide content filtering. This approach provides consistency but potentially limits community autonomy. The platform's reliance on central oversight contrasts with Mastodon's community-driven governance, where individual instances maintain sovereignty over content decisions.

Both platforms' approaches reflect broader industry tensions between centralized control and distributed governance.

While Mastodon prioritizes community autonomy, Bluesky emphasizes standardized moderation practices, each model presenting distinct advantages and challenges for platform governance.
